The First International Symposium on Chinese Language Studies, jointly
organized by the Department of Chinese and the Department of Linguistics of
the University of Hong Kong, will be held at the University of Hong Kong on
March 12-14, 2002. The symposium programme and abstracts of the papers can
be viewed at:
http://www.hku.hk/chinese/symposium/
Further details of the symposium can be obtained from Professor CY Sin
(cysin at hkucc.hku.hk),
Department of Chinese, University of Hong Kong or Dr K K Luke, Department of
Linguistics, University of Hong Kong(kkluke at hkusua.hku.hk).
